在編程中,循環(huán)語句是非常重要的一部分。而其中,while do語句是一種常用的循環(huán)語句,它可以讓程序反復(fù)執(zhí)行某個(gè)操作,直到滿足特定條件才停止。掌握while do語句,能夠讓你的編程之路更加暢通。
一、while do語句的基本語法
while do語句的基本語法如下
```dition)
// 執(zhí)行的代碼塊
ditiondition的值為false時(shí),while循環(huán)就會(huì)停止。
二、while do語句的使用場景
while do語句適用于需要反復(fù)執(zhí)行某個(gè)操作,直到滿足特定條件才停止的情況。比如,讀取文件中的數(shù)據(jù),直到文件結(jié)束;循環(huán)處理輸入的數(shù)據(jù),直到滿足結(jié)束條件等。
舉個(gè)例子,比如我們要計(jì)算1到100之間的所有整數(shù)的和,可以使用while do語句來實(shí)現(xiàn)
```t i = 1;t = 0;
while (i<= 100)
{ += i;
i++;
+= i和i++兩個(gè)語句,直到i的值大于100為止。
三、while do語句的注意事項(xiàng)
1. 在使用while do語句時(shí),一定要注意循環(huán)條件的設(shè)置,否則可能會(huì)出現(xiàn)死循環(huán)的情況。
2. 在while do語句中,循環(huán)條件的值可以在代碼塊中改變,從而影響循環(huán)的執(zhí)行。
3. 如果循環(huán)條件的值一開始就為false,那么while do語句中的代碼塊將不會(huì)被執(zhí)行。
while do語句是一種常用的循環(huán)語句,可以讓程序反復(fù)執(zhí)行某個(gè)操作,直到滿足特定條件才停止。在編程中,合理使用while do語句,可以提高程序的效率和可讀性。因此,掌握while do語句的使用方法,對(duì)于編程初學(xué)者來說是非常重要的。